Understanding Water Quality Challenges in St. Cloud, MO
Residents of St. Cloud, MO 63080 often face specific water quality issues due to the natural composition of the local groundwater. One of the most common problems is the presence of iron in the water supply. Iron can cause a range of issues including unpleasant taste and odor, staining on fixtures and laundry, and can even promote the growth of iron bacteria which leads to further complications.
How Iron Affects Water Quality in St. Cloud
Iron in water typically comes from the natural erosion of iron-rich rocks and soil. In St. Cloud, the groundwater often contains dissolved iron, which is clear when in solution but oxidizes and turns reddish-brown when exposed to air. This oxidation process leads to visible rust-colored stains on sinks, tubs, and clothing. Additionally, iron can impart a metallic taste to drinking water and may cause clogging in pipes and water systems over time.
The Role of the Nelsen Iron Filter
The Nelsen iron filter is designed specifically to address iron contamination in water. It works by oxidizing dissolved iron and then filtering out the resulting particles, effectively reducing iron concentration to safe and acceptable levels. This filtration process not only improves the aesthetic qualities of water but also helps protect plumbing systems and appliances from iron-related damage.
Benefits of Proper Water Treatment with Nelsen Iron Filters
- Improved Water Taste and Appearance: By removing iron, water becomes clearer and free of metallic taste and odors.
- Prevention of Staining: Eliminates rust-colored stains on fixtures, clothing, and dishes.
- Protection of Plumbing and Appliances: Reduces buildup that can cause blockages and corrosion, extending the lifespan of water-using equipment.
- Health and Safety: While iron is not typically harmful in small amounts, controlling its presence helps maintain overall water quality and reduces the risk of bacterial growth.
